首页 > 解决方案 > 使用 ImageSharp 从调色板索引创建图像

问题描述

我有一个字节数组,代表图像像素的调色板索引,我正在尝试使用 ImageSharp 将其转换为图像,因此我可以稍后将其保存为 PNG,但我似乎无法找到如何,谁能给我一个关于在哪里看的想法?调色板不重要,我只需要 N 种不同的颜色。

标签: .net-coreimagesharp

解决方案


ImageSharp 图像表示扩展的像素缓冲区,而不是对调色板的引用。如果您有原始调色板,请使用它来创建实际像素数据的输入缓冲区。所描述的字节数组实际上不是完全解码的图像。

将颜色集减少到最大量是量化的问题。有允许您执行此操作的方法以及允许以索引格式保存图像的编码选项。


推荐阅读